About this item:
Made for iMac: Designed to work with both old and new Thunderbolt 3 iMacs to make ports much easier to access. Not compatible with iMacs with Thunderbolt 2 ports.
5-in-1: Connect to your iMac's Thunderbolt 3 port to get access to SD and microSD card slots, 2 USB-A ports, and a USB-C port.
Make Ports Easy to Reach: No more awkwardly stretching or reaching to use the ports on the back of your iMac. With this hub, you'll have 5 ports right in front of you every time you need them.
Transfer Files at High Speed: Both USB ports and the USB-C port support a maximum file transfer speed of 10 Gbps, while the SD and microSD card slots let you transfer your latest photos at up to 312 MB/s.
